Vetco Gray said its slimbore wellhead systems would enable Shell to drill and complete wells using smaller risers and blowout prevents, allowing it to use conventionally rated rigs to target the BC-10 project's prospects in water up to 1930 metres deep. The use of smaller rigs in deep-water exploration would help to keep costs down, it said.
The project would mark the first time Shell used a surface blowout preventer for deep-water in-field development, Vetco Gray said.
